Heating, Air Conditioning, and Refrigeration Mechanics and Installers
Heating, Air Conditioning, and Refrigeration Mechanics and Installers
01
Test electrical circuits or components for continuity, using electrical test equipment.
02
Comply with all applicable standards, policies, or procedures, such as safety procedures or the maintenance of a clean work area.
03
Study blueprints, design specifications, or manufacturers' recommendations to ascertain the configuration of heating or cooling equipment components and to ensure the proper installation of components.
04
Discuss heating or cooling system malfunctions with users to isolate problems or to verify that repairs corrected malfunctions.
05
Connect heating or air conditioning equipment to fuel, water, or refrigerant source to form complete circuit.
06
Adjust system controls to settings recommended by manufacturer to balance system.
07
Recommend, develop, or perform preventive or general maintenance procedures, such as cleaning, power-washing, or vacuuming equipment, oiling parts, or changing filters.
08
Inspect and test systems to verify system compliance with plans and specifications or to detect and locate malfunctions.
09
Repair or replace defective equipment, components, or wiring.
10
Install or repair self-contained ground source heat pumps or hybrid ground or air source heat pumps to minimize carbon-based energy consumption and reduce carbon emissions.

**Job Title:** Refrigeration Service Technician
**Principal Duties and Responsibilities**
+ The Refrigeration Service Technician is responsible for the operations, repairs, replacement, and preventative maintenance of commercial and industrial refrigeration equipment.
+ Must have a working knowledge of rack systems, walk-in coolers and freezers, ice machines, reach-in coolers and freezers, and basic HVAC equipment, including rooftop units, exhaust fans, make-up air units and associated electrical equipment.
+ Ability to diagnose and repair refrigeration equipment to include:
+ Strong understanding of the refrigeration circuit
+ Understand superheating and subcooling.
+ Hot gas circuits and operations
+ CPR’s EPR’s and head pressure control valves (ORI, OROA, LAC)
+ TXV/Orifice operations
+ Ability to perform leak checks (electronically and pressurized)
+ Ability to solder, braze, and pipe fit.
+ Understand reciprocating compressor operation.
+ Use different types of compressor oils.
+ Understand electrical circuits and processors.
+ Defrost clocks.
+ Defrost heaters.
+ Contactors
+ Relays
+ CPC Processors
+ Technicians will be familiar with all refrigeration equipment and all refrigerants.
+ Work with the Dispatch Team to ensure that the workload is accomplished in a complete and timely manner.
+ The individual must maintain safe work practices in support of the OSHA Health & Safety and NFPA 70e standards as it applies when performing the assigned duties.

Job Summary:
HVAC installers will be responsible for installing and inspecting HVAC systems working from a blueprint. Installers work with blueprints when they install AC systems homes, and other structures. They install various sizes of boxes and ducting for the supply system. Install and solder copper lines for refrigerant as well as sealing and securing ducting inside attics. Equipment installation and vast knowledge in all tools required to perform a full HVAC system installation without supervision or additional direction.
HVAC Installer Functions Include but are not limited to:
• Read technical diagrams, blueprints and various paperwork for accurate installations.
• Install ducting, equipment and other components according to print.
• Install, repair or replace HVAC equipment & system components.
• Follow State building code and local building regulations.
• Good knowledge of various test equipment and tool operation.
• Measure, cut lumber, using measuring instruments, hand and powertools.
• Maintain tools, vehicles, and equipment and keep parts and supplies in order.
• Perform semi-skilled and unskilled laboring duties related to the installation.
• Break up concrete, using chipping hammer, to facilitate installation.
• Install all required components for the HVAC system.
• Transport tools, materials, equipment, and supplies to work site by hand.
• Construct platforms, ducting boxes, using power drills, saws and hand tools.
• Raise, lower, or position equipment, tools, and materials
